前端网站如何做全景图360浏览器个别网页打不开怎么解决
web/
2025/10/1 0:01:59/
文章来源:
前端网站如何做全景图,360浏览器个别网页打不开怎么解决,网站平台建设项目书,wordpress 企业 下载http://blog.csdn.net/seusoftware/archive/2010/04/24/5524414.aspx引用一、综述命名和编码过程中#xff0c;定义有意义的名称#xff0c;以易于理解、方便书写为原则。(1)避免使用中文#xff0c;尽量使用全拼音或全英文#xff0c;以方便国际化#xff1b;(2)避免拼音…http://blog.csdn.net/seusoftware/archive/2010/04/24/5524414.aspx引用一、综述命名和编码过程中定义有意义的名称以易于理解、方便书写为原则。(1)避免使用中文尽量使用全拼音或全英文以方便国际化(2)避免拼音和英文的中西合璧如CAOZUO_TIME(3)避免在命名中包括空格及特殊字符(4)避免使用保留字(5)避免名称太长注意缩写的使用缩写规则为单词前4个字母合成词取每个单词前两位组成4位缩写对于约定束成的缩写不必遵守取4位的规则比如NO代表NUMBER如果取NUMB反而让人费解。二、命名规范2.1、数据库前缀使用与数据库业务对象相对应的英文单词或英文缩写名称使用与数据库业务性质相对应的英文单词或英文缩写举例BHO_STATISTIC注意(1)名称一律使用单数形式(2)动词一律保持动宾结构通常增、删、改、查、统计的动作使用ADD、DEL、UPD、QRY、STA作为缩写以降低命名的长度2.2、数据库文件及文件组(1)数据库文件存放路径D:\DATA、E:\LOG(2)数据库文件组命名主文件组 PRIMARY,次文件组 FG_业务模块_数据分类如FG_CONFIG_ACCOUNT(3)数据库主数据文件命名DBNAME_DATA.MDF如BHO_STATISTIC_DATA.MDF(4)数据库从数据文件命名DBNAME_DATA_XX.NDFXX为两位整数不足两位第1位用0补齐如BHO_STATISTIC_DATA_01.NDF(5)数据库日志文件命名DBNAME_LOG_XX.LDFXX为两位整数不足两位第1位用0补齐,如BHO_STATISTIC_LOG_01.LDF2.3、数据库逻辑对象2.3.1、架构通常使用业务模块名作为架构名如配置模块(CONFIG)。(1)方便数据库对象分类(2)方便权限管理。2.3.2、表前缀、名称、后缀均以下划线(_)间隔字母均使用大写。(1) 实体表前缀ETB(E表示ENTITY)名称架构名.ETB_名词举例PUBLIC.ETB_LEAGUE(2)关系表前缀RTB(R表示RELATION)名称架构名.RTB_实体英文单词缩写_实体英文单词缩写[_实体英文单词缩写…]举例PUBLIC.RTB_HOPA_LEAG(即CONFIG.RTB_HOMEPAGE_LEAGUE)(3)事实表前缀FACT名称架构名.FACT_动宾结构举例CONFIG.FACT _ADD_USER(4)报表前缀RPT(REPORT的简写)名称架构名.RPT_动宾结构举例CONFIG.RPT_ ADD_USER(5)字段名称词_词全部大写举例FIRST_NAME注意a)避免字段名中包含表名如EMPLOYEE_FIRST_NAMEb)避免使用数字如COLUMN_1、COLUMN_2c)避免字段名包含数据类型如COLUMN_CHAR、COLUMN_NUMBERc)冗余字段可考虑加上前缀X或R如X_COL_NAME(6)索引前缀IX用两个字母是为了和约束一致起来约束PK、FK、UQ、CK、DF、NL名称表名_列名1[_列名2…]为避免索引名太长也可以使用表名_NN为自然数举例IX_ CONFIG _FACT_ADD_USER_FACT_ID、IX_ CONFIG _FACT_ADD_USER_12.3.3、视图前缀V名称架构名.V_动宾结构举例CONFIG .V_QRY_USER2.3.4、存储过程前缀P名称架构名.P_动宾结构举例CONFIG .P_ADD_USER2.3.5、触发器前缀Tr名称架构名.Tr_动宾结构举例CONFIG.Tr_ADD_USER2.3.6、函数前缀F名称架构名.F_动宾结构举例CONFIG.F_QRY_USER其他未列举的数据库逻辑对象可参考以上规则进行命名。三、编码规范3.1、外部参数(1)对使用频繁、关键性的变量请在定义时加上注释标明其含义(2)尽量少用单字母变量禁止使用诸如i、j等作为变量名(3)注意小写字母l和数字1之间的区别使用(4)参数命名约定名称_名称变量名称全部用小写以示与表中大写字段区别如user_name3.2、内部参数同外部参数3.3、关键字及系统内置对象(1)关键字、系统函数、系统变量等全部大写(2)数据类型使用小写以与参数一致3.4、代码块(1)使用TAB来缩进设置TAB 4并将TAB自动转换为空格(2)每行控制在列边界80以内(3)注释全部另起一行不要和代码合在一行单行注释采用--多行注释采用/* 注释内容 */。另外注释内容尽量使用英文中文注释在英文版的DBMS中可能会导致错误。(4)多个Begin…End语句嵌套时采用如下方式BEGIN /*1*/...BEGIN /*1.1*/...BEGIN /*1.1.1*/...END /*1.1.1*/BEGIN /*1.1.2*/...END /*1.1.2*/END /*1.1*/END /*1*/其中1表示第一级嵌套1.1表示第二级嵌套1.1.1表示第三级嵌套1.1.2表示第三级的第二个嵌套… 一般不要超过三级嵌套。(5)在保证缩进格式的前提下可以通过对齐关键字来提高代码的可读性如下SELECT *FROM SCHEMA_NAME.TABLE_NAMEWHERE COL_NAME XXX3.5、可编程对象3.5.1、代码模板推荐使用SQL SERVER开发工具中的模板来生成格式再根据个人习惯进行适当修改即可。3.5.2、全文注释/******************************************************************用 途作 者创建日期调用举例修订记录 修改内容简要说明******************************************************************//******************************************************************Function:Author:Createdate:execute e.g:modify record::description******************************************************************/3.5.3、返回值存储过程中的返回值分两种RETURN和OUTPUT参数。(1)RETURN值作为存储过程的执行状态0为正常结束非0为异常结束。(2)使用OUTPUT参数返回错误编号和错误文本以供弹出提示分享到 2011-01-21 13:14浏览 1325评论
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/84725.shtml
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!